Battle of Crete 4 Day Private WW2 War History Tour
For those interested in exploring the history of World War II in Crete, the 4-day private WW2 War History Tour is a comprehensive option. Priced at $895.95 per person, this tour offers a deep dive into the Battle of Crete, visiting villages that suffered German reprisals, evacuation spots of Allied troops, and places of great significance during the battle. Led by a specialized trilingual guide with expertise in history, archaeology, and contemporary history, the tour includes private air-conditioned transport, snacks, drinks, and a surprise gift at the end.
Across the 4-day itinerary, you’ll visit war memorials, access abandoned German and Allied war bunkers and hideouts, and learn about the Cretan resistance. While the tour excludes gratuities, lunch, and entrance fees, it provides a flexible and insightful exploration of this pivotal World War II event, with free cancellation and the option to reserve now and pay later.

Explore Preveli Palms, Damnoni Beach & Historic Rethymno
Set out on a captivating journey through Preveli Palms, Damnoni Beach, and the historic heart of Rethymno. This full-day tour showcases the natural splendor and cultural richness of Crete.
Start by exploring the serene Preveli Palms, where you’ll wander through a lush palm forest along the banks of a river. Then, head to the picturesque Damnoni Beach, where you can relax on the golden sands or take a refreshing dip in the crystal-clear waters.
Next, learn about the charming old town of Rethymno, a well-preserved medieval city with a rich history. Stroll through the narrow streets, admire the Venetian and Ottoman architecture, and visit the imposing Fortezza, a 16th-century fortress that offers panoramic views of the city. This comprehensive tour provides a perfect balance of natural beauty and cultural exploration, allowing you to experience the best of Rethymno in a single day.
